lazyscribe

View on PyPIReverse Dependencies (2)

1.1.0 lazyscribe-1.1.0-py3-none-any.whl

Wheel Details

Project: lazyscribe
Version: 1.1.0
Filename: lazyscribe-1.1.0-py3-none-any.whl
Download: [link]
Size: 34340
MD5: 23697dacb6c8d7b91cc7ea210b246eb8
SHA256: 5d0ecb729cb42b9b8ba44dbbf2a60afbd01f93ee3e280db06bae39345e21d000
Uploaded: 2025-03-14 14:41:31 +0000

dist-info

METADATA

Metadata-Version: 2.2
Name: lazyscribe
Version: 1.1.0
Summary: Lightweight and lazy experiment logging
Author-Email: Akshay Gupta <akgcodes[at]gmail.com>
Project-Url: documentation, https://lazyscribe.github.io/lazyscribe/
Project-Url: repository, https://github.com/lazyscribe/lazyscribe
License: MIT license
Classifier: Development Status :: 4 - Beta
Classifier: License :: OSI Approved :: MIT License
Classifier: Natural Language :: English
Classifier: Programming Language :: Python :: 3
Classifier: Programming Language :: Python :: 3 :: Only
Classifier: Programming Language :: Python :: 3.9
Classifier: Programming Language :: Python :: 3.10
Classifier: Programming Language :: Python :: 3.11
Classifier: Programming Language :: Python :: 3.12
Classifier: Programming Language :: Python :: 3.13
Requires-Python: >=3.9.0
Requires-Dist: attrs (<=25.1.0,>=21.2.0)
Requires-Dist: importlib-metadata (<=8.5.0,>=6.0)
Requires-Dist: python-slugify (<=8.0.4,>=5.0.0)
Requires-Dist: fsspec (<=2025.2.0,>=0.4.0)
Requires-Dist: build; extra == "build"
Requires-Dist: commitizen; extra == "build"
Requires-Dist: twine; extra == "build"
Requires-Dist: wheel; extra == "build"
Requires-Dist: furo; extra == "docs"
Requires-Dist: matplotlib; extra == "docs"
Requires-Dist: pandas; extra == "docs"
Requires-Dist: pillow; extra == "docs"
Requires-Dist: prefect (<2,>=1.0); extra == "docs"
Requires-Dist: scikit-learn; extra == "docs"
Requires-Dist: sphinx; extra == "docs"
Requires-Dist: sphinx-gallery; extra == "docs"
Requires-Dist: sphinx-inline-tabs; extra == "docs"
Requires-Dist: ruff (==0.7.3); extra == "qa"
Requires-Dist: edgetest; extra == "qa"
Requires-Dist: mypy; extra == "qa"
Requires-Dist: pip-tools; extra == "qa"
Requires-Dist: pre-commit; extra == "qa"
Requires-Dist: types-python-slugify; extra == "qa"
Requires-Dist: types-PyYAML; extra == "qa"
Requires-Dist: scikit-learn; extra == "tests"
Requires-Dist: prefect (<2,>=1.0); extra == "tests"
Requires-Dist: pytest; extra == "tests"
Requires-Dist: pytest-cov; extra == "tests"
Requires-Dist: time-machine; extra == "tests"
Requires-Dist: PyYAML; extra == "tests"
Requires-Dist: lazyscribe[build]; extra == "dev"
Requires-Dist: lazyscribe[docs]; extra == "dev"
Requires-Dist: lazyscribe[qa]; extra == "dev"
Requires-Dist: lazyscribe[tests]; extra == "dev"
Provides-Extra: build
Provides-Extra: docs
Provides-Extra: qa
Provides-Extra: tests
Provides-Extra: dev
Description-Content-Type: text/markdown
License-File: LICENSE
[Description omitted; length: 2561 characters]

WHEEL

Wheel-Version: 1.0
Generator: setuptools (76.0.0)
Root-Is-Purelib: true
Tag: py3-none-any

RECORD

Path Digest Size
lazyscribe/__init__.py sha256=FAen46LyeSJl8cUqmithXxEqjjtP4DIKnYuq2883oT0 316
lazyscribe/_meta.py sha256=W1TjJNvbSNm-TFa15Yoy2Issa4SsEWXV3xLNjI6i0Q0 38
lazyscribe/_utils.py sha256=VdWdJsvfbJyJf2qrZKYymzeIv0AH9gfd4LkMeQSkhlI 2041
lazyscribe/exception.py sha256=xqT4Acwqy5BUqPgXsRYySfGqm_P67_bDpZwDFnZ94f0 670
lazyscribe/experiment.py sha256=ypZ1VZ0a1Mhxkop7rV2vKlGfSxu8IU3Yy6zspv1tXH0 22351
lazyscribe/linked.py sha256=1933cDEQu5VLDbGOqMI6vyDyAChUJ1q2ZXWK0TkTySo 2633
lazyscribe/project.py sha256=sfi3V2s_ORSg6arCjgIzZwgA1-cS3KROcUY4E7Zia-s 15966
lazyscribe/repository.py sha256=PlV5tQ3fEg8HCGmL3lbDQ8i2NSjtZaFzqdnIUZl3rx8 16689
lazyscribe/test.py sha256=7MbMwSALUWwgool8k4SliGQmLEE_-angz3mWNGzgJbo 4040
lazyscribe/artifacts/__init__.py sha256=ODFbyrK8NfQVoVLebZ5JKBCbk4HCAiyqij-9SK2TSPA 1615
lazyscribe/artifacts/base.py sha256=650rjCyXjsuFZ-2grkY7qutZ1jqQrGcXQOcOy6tWdaU 4945
lazyscribe/artifacts/joblib.py sha256=yQROIL2M7D_5xLeRAovCp-3NVNV3w6umLysh6nWOmt8 6099
lazyscribe/artifacts/json.py sha256=BTOsv0dN2LSgbWyH12ZsStYGL9Bebb-T3D2uP1yZf-o 3870
lazyscribe/artifacts/yaml.py sha256=3u2kui_3bo6hBJxhgJgFEModRaiIC3L7bZWk2tyXJaI 2457
lazyscribe/prefect/__init__.py sha256=urvWI4ZFwMDKoNPT8vpPmC59X096xU7IfT3jjryHk0o 579
lazyscribe/prefect/experiment.py sha256=XW_rLt-HJV7A0QmwgZ5k4aEDvAZwxSu8M_EJoJQqB6A 9265
lazyscribe/prefect/project.py sha256=UOibe5-TA1fKcMfojHELpmFFrfmYoFOS9YUXarjGouY 9445
lazyscribe/prefect/test.py sha256=jyGHuB7VOae2uzPb2NF3vPPBM5bydC8KHEPkrOoK2yg 2799
lazyscribe-1.1.0.dist-info/LICENSE sha256=osGzBuQIfPaUaKoszKa9QcGAvUL2oqbQRmB3D7FREXU 1069
lazyscribe-1.1.0.dist-info/METADATA sha256=WN79w-26zJestTECs3lFrO8AN7mMIapZc8hfd1cbJPg 5019
lazyscribe-1.1.0.dist-info/WHEEL sha256=52BFRY2Up02UkjOa29eZOS2VxUrpPORXg1pkohGGUS8 91
lazyscribe-1.1.0.dist-info/entry_points.txt sha256=qsXuWCTxDEFwCUg0XSictQqZkoFmG-1MowdHbVdotJc 213
lazyscribe-1.1.0.dist-info/top_level.txt sha256=Ge22vqzeczFYLZ5SYe6u9H-XxgFscnBV1F-sdyk8YVE 11
lazyscribe-1.1.0.dist-info/RECORD

top_level.txt

lazyscribe

entry_points.txt

base = lazyscribe.artifacts.base:Artifact
joblib = lazyscribe.artifacts.joblib:JoblibArtifact
json = lazyscribe.artifacts.json:JSONArtifact
yaml = lazyscribe.artifacts.yaml:YAMLArtifact